小编Sta*_*seR的帖子

以编程方式在Microsoft Print to PDF打印机中设置文件名和路径

我有一个C# .net程序,可以创建各种文档.这些文件应存储在不同的位置,并使用不同的,明确定义的名称.

为此,我使用了这门System.Drawing.Printing.PrintDocument课程.我Microsoft Print to PDF用这个语句选择as printer:

PrintDocument.PrinterSettings.PrinterName = "Microsoft Print to PDF";

在这样做的同时,我能够以一种方式打印我的文档pdf file.用户获得文件选择对话框.然后,他可以在此对话框中指定pdf文件的名称以及存储位置.

由于文件数量很大,并且总是找到正确的路径和名称很烦人并且容易出错,因此我想以编程方式在此对话框中设置正确的路径和文件名.

我已经测试了这些属性:

PrintDocument.PrinterSettings.PrintFileName PrintDocument.DocumentName

将所需的路径和文件名写入这些属性没有帮助.有谁知道,如何Microsoft Print to PDF在C#中为打印机设置路径和文件名的默认值?

注意:我的环境:Windows 10,Visual Studio 2010,.net framework 4.5

.net c# windows printing pdf

7
推荐指数
1
解决办法
9544
查看次数

Xamarin:不支持@(内容)构建操作

我正在 VS Pro 2015(Xamarin) 中开发 Android 应用程序。一切都工作正常,直到今天早上我更新了我的 Android 设备。我能够构建我的应用程序,但在部署到我的设备时,我收到一堆警告,说明@(Content) build action is not supported其他人似乎已经通过将AndroidManifest.xml构建操作设置为None来修复,但我的AndroidManifest.xml的构建操作已经是设置为无。

我已经检查了警告中所有指定的文件。其中大多数.png将 Build 操作设置为Android Resource(我也尝试过 Build Action ->Content但没有成功),其中一些将.xmlBuild 操作设置为Content

这是我的代码窗口的屏幕截图。

警告

对于重复标记:我已经在堆栈交换上尝试过与此相关的 Xamarin 帖子。几乎不应该有20个帖子!但没有一个对我有用。

c# xamarin.android visual-studio-2015

5
推荐指数
1
解决办法
7358
查看次数

文件内容搜索c#

我正在尝试在我的应用程序中实现此功能。

文件内容搜索

就像在 Windows 中一样,我在搜索框中输入内容,如果在设置中选中了文件内容,则无论它是文本文件还是 pdf/word 文件,搜索都会返回包含搜索框中字符串的文件。

因此,我已经开发出了一个用于文件和文件夹搜索的应用程序,该应用程序对于文本文件和 Word 文件非常有效file content search。我正在使用互操作字来处理字文件。

我知道,我可以使用iTextSharp或其他一些第三方工具来对 pdf 文件执行此操作。但这并不能令我满意。我只是想知道windows是怎么做到的?或者如果其他人以不同的方式做到了?我只是不想使用任何第三方工具,但这并不意味着我不能。我只是想让我的应用程序保持轻量级,而不是用许多工具来抛弃它。

c# wpf full-text-search pdf-reader winforms

5
推荐指数
1
解决办法
1231
查看次数